RNZI broadcasts on digital and analogue short wave to radio stations and individual listeners across the region. Around twenty Pacific radio stations relay RNZI material daily, and individual short-wave listeners and internet users across the world tune in directly to RNZI content. The RNZI short-wave signal can sometimes be heard as far away as Japan, North America, the Middle East and Europe

Mailbox is presented by Myra Oh
- with regular contributors , Bryan Clark, and John Durham who provide
DX Reviews. Kevin Hand reviews the "Utility Bands". There are
occasional features on Pacific Radio from David Riquish, and Chris Makerell
reports on digital radio DRM. Frequency Manager Adrian Sainsbury, answers
technical questions.
You can also hear the latest solar propagation news supplied by IPS
Radio & Space Services. IPS scientists keep watch on the Sun
and forecast future conditions for short-wave radio reception.
This programme is aimed at the dedicated short-wave listener.
